Q: Is 73,535 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 73,535 is not a prime number.

Why is 73,535 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 73535 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 11 35 55 77 191 385 955 1,337 2,101 6,685 10,505 14,707 and 73,535, with no remainder.

Since 73,535 cannot be divided by just 1 and 73,535, it is not a prime number.
